Sterlite Technologies on Friday reported a sharp dip of 76.8 per cent at Rs 17.10 crore in its standalone net profit for the third quarter ended December 31.

The provider of transmission solutions for the power and telecom industries, had posted a net profit of Rs 73.72 crore in the October-December quarter last fiscal, Sterlite Technologies said in a filing to the Bombay Stock Exchange.

The net revenues of the company also declined to Rs 579.11 crore in the December quarter compared with Rs 867.27 crore in the year-ago period.

Commenting on the third quarter numbers, Sterlite Technologies Wholetime Director Mr Pravin Agarwal said, “We are working actively towards ensuring a return to our normal performance, with expanded capacities and good order book for the fiscal year 2012 and beyond.”

Shares of the company closed at Rs 55.30 down 10.30 per cent after hitting a 52-week low of Rs 54.15 a piece during intra-day on BSE.
